So here we have the 2 in 1 planner and December Daily. You will not need a printer or anything too fancy to make the pages of the planner. Just your favourite papers, notebooks, elastic and a laminator. All products I have used will be linked down below. You can change the sizes to suit your notebooks too.

Dimensions
Main Cover – 8″x 8.75″ Score at 4″, 4 3/8″ & 4.75″
Notebook Covers (x4) – 8 1/8″x 7 7/8″ Score at 4″ & 4 1/8″ with the 8 1/8″ side along the top of the board
Pockets (x2) – 3 7/8″x 4″ Mark 2″ on 1 side and trim corner off as per video
